Walter A. Sinz (July 13, 1881 – 1966) was an American sculptor born in Cleveland, Ohio.[1] Among his best-known work was the Thompson Trophy.[2] He was educated at the Cleveland School of Art, where he also taught from 1911 to 1952. In addition to his bronze and medal work, he designed figures for Cowan Pottery.
